Output de905c832591669e2e0f8cc58903092d3e3e3d8b87e087205d81b76d6b287e15:11

value
2027552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c8d5d82b374206b33f2a490dbf71f006d3ace7 OP_EQUAL
address
32DbtnZCW2HhFHVuxjRNvMXHaxamZCUJKm
transaction
de905c832591669e2e0f8cc58903092d3e3e3d8b87e087205d81b76d6b287e15
spent
true